What is Volvo Android Automotive?
First off, let's clarify what we're talking about. Volvo Android Automotive isn't just your regular Android Auto, which mirrors your phone's screen onto the car's display. Instead, it's a full-fledged Android operating system built directly into the car. This means the car's infotainment system, including navigation, media, climate control, and more, runs on Android. Think of it as having a giant Android tablet seamlessly integrated into your dashboard.
The Benefits of Android Automotive are numerous. For starters, it allows for over-the-air (OTA) updates, meaning your car's software can be upgraded remotely, just like your smartphone. This keeps your system fresh with the latest features and improvements without needing a trip to the dealership. Plus, it opens the door for a whole ecosystem of apps and services directly accessible from your car's touchscreen. Imagine having Google Maps, Spotify, and your favorite podcast apps all built-in and optimized for your driving experience. Latest Updates and Features
So, what's new in the world of Volvo Android Automotive? Volvo has been rolling out some exciting updates recently. One of the most significant improvements is the enhanced Google Assistant integration. You can now use voice commands to control even more car functions, such as adjusting the climate control, setting navigation destinations, and even making calls. It's like having a virtual co-pilot that understands your every need. Another cool feature is the improved Google Maps integration. The navigation system is now more intuitive, providing real-time traffic updates, lane guidance, and even charging station suggestions for electric vehicles. Plus, the map display is beautifully rendered on the car's touchscreen, making it easy to follow directions. Volvo is also continuously adding new apps to the Google Play Store for Android Automotive. This means you can now access a wider range of entertainment, productivity, and utility apps directly from your car. Whether you're streaming music, listening to audiobooks, or even managing your to-do list, Android Automotive has you covered. The over-the-air update capability ensures that these new features and improvements are seamlessly delivered to your car, keeping your system up-to-date without any hassle. Volvo Models with Android Automotive
Wondering which Volvo models come with this cool system? You'll find Android Automotive in the newer models, including the Volvo XC40 Recharge, C40 Recharge, XC60, XC90, S90, and V90. Volvo is committed to rolling out Android Automotive across its entire lineup, so you can expect to see it in more models in the future.
